If you watched the video already, go to the. If you don’t want to watch the video, or can’t, read on The central entities in Docear are annotations, i.e. Comments, highlighted text, and bookmarks that you create in PDF files.
This means, after downloading a PDF, you read it with your favorite PDF viewer and annotate anything you consider important and that you might want to look-up or cite later. Research categories created by a user, and the contained PDFs and annotations The next step is drafting your own paper, assignment, thesis, or book. To start, create a new mind map. From your previously created literature mind map you can copy all the PDFs and annotations you need.

Operating System Docear runs on Windows (XP, Vista, 7, 8, 10, or later), Linux, or Mac OS (10.5 or later) Java 1.5 (or later) Java is the programming language in which Docear (and many other programs) is written in. To run a software written in Java, you need to install the free Java Runtime Environment (Java JRE). Probably you have already installed Java. Install Docear Installation should be straight forward. • Windows: double click the docear.exe file and follow the instructions on the screen • MacOS: Start the.dmg file • Linux: You should know how to do it 😉 First Start Initial Settings When you start Docear for the first time, you will be asked whether you want to register, log-in, or use Docear as a local user. We highly suggest to register, because it will give you many free benefits such as literature recommendations, metadata retrieval, and backup of your data.
However, registration requires to provide us with your email address, and under some (e.g. If you activate recommendations), Docear will statistically analyze your mind maps. If you don’t want any data of yours to be analyzed, use Docear as ‘local user’. Please note: Currently, all online services are disabled.
In the next step, you need to decide about where to store your data. If you are completely new to academia, and have no PDFs yet, you may start from scratch: Select a project name (e.g. “Course ABC”, “My Dissertation”, “Book XYZ”, ), and a project home. The project home is the folder that shall contain all your data including PDFs, images, Excel sheets,etc. An appropriate project home could be, for instance, “c: University ”, or “ My Documents Work ”, or “ Dropbox PhD Stuff, If you have already some data on your hard drive that you want to use with Docear, you need to select the second radio button.

This allows you to choose a project name, your project home and the folder(s) in which you store your PDFs and BibTeX files. We highly recommend to have your PDFs and BibTeX files in a sub-folder of your project home.
For instance, if your project home is c: work, a good place for your PDFs would be c: work literature or c: work pdfs but not c: temp literature because that wouldn’t be a subfolder of c: work. If you want to choose a folder e.g. In your Dropbox, you can also do this.
The path would be something like c: Users Dropbox University (you shouldn’t use the entire Dropbox as your project home). If you have been using another reference manager, read how to use or at the same time, or how to. Selecting a PDF Editor Docear will ask you which PDF editor you want to use with Docear. To enjoy Docear’s full potential it is really important that you select a PDF reader that is supported by Docear. Otherwise you won’t be able to open annotations directly on the correct page or you won’t be able to import annotations.
